Huygens is one of the income portfolios that is constructed around Closed-End-Funds.  It is best to use this approach with tax deferred accounts as much of the growth is tied to dividends.  This is a relative new investing model here at ITA and as … [Read more]

The Darwin Portfolio is a relatively inert portfolio in that all assets in the portfolio quiver are held continuously (Buy-and-Hold) in allocations designed to keep the risk from each asset at defined levels as calculated from volatility measurements … [Read more]
